First up is my favorite purchase in this haul, the Too Faced Milk Chocolate Soleil! I’ve always wanted to try a bronzer, but most of them run too dark or orange for my fair complexion. I tested this bronzer a couple of times in different stores, and finally took the plunge! My review is glowing so far. The bronzer warms my face or works for a nice contour as well! Plus, it has a wonderful chocolate smell that I can’t resist! My sister bought the Too Faced Chocolate Bar Palette and the smell had me wanting that product too!

Next up is a small sample of the NARS creamy concealer in the color vanilla. So far, I’m not that impressed with this concealer. For $12, the size is extremely small and the concealer is a little sticky for me. I still prefer my Maybelline Fit Me concealer so far, but I’m going to keep trying this one out for a while.
Next up is the tarte CC undereye corrector. I’ve never tried a color corrector before, but this product really does mask my undereye circles almost immediately! It is a bit sticky, so you might want to layer on a creamier concealer, but it works well on its own too.

I made a quick stop in the MAC store after Sephora and bought the eyeliner in Costa Riche. This is another recommendation from Kathleen and is supposed to look great with green eyes. I can attest that this warm brown does bring out my eye color a lot, and stays on pretty well too!
